Polish businessmen explore investment opportunities in Laâyoune and Dakhla

A large delegation of Polish businessmen began on Monday an economic mission to Laâyoune and Dakhla to prospect investment opportunities in the southern provinces of the kingdom, under the organization by the Moroccan embassy in Warsaw, in collaboration with the regional investment centers (CRIs) of the southern provinces.

According to the Embassy in Warsaw, this is the crowning achievement of efforts to bring together and prospecting on the part of Polish private entrepreneurs who had materialized their decision to invest in the kingdom in declarations signed this year during working sessions in Warsaw. .

The purpose of this visit is in particular to learn about the development efforts made by Morocco at the national and regional levels, in particular in the southern provinces, and to get an idea of ​​the potential investment sectors, with a view to create wealth and employment opportunities in the region.

These Polish firms which responded to the invitation of the embassy will hold meetings with representatives of IRCs in the region, B2B meetings with Moroccan companies and visits to major structuring projects.

Polish companies work in the sectors of manufacturing professional lighting solutions, the technology of manufacturing ultralight helicopters for multiple purposes, including in the sanitary and agricultural industry, the production of electric poles, lighting and telecommunications, the production of charging stations for electric cars, the manufacture of firefighting equipment and materials and the production of specialized containers for the military and civilian market.
